The origins of Champagne 243 are divided as follows: one third comes from the "Rivière" vineyard, one third from the "Montagne" vineyard and one third from the "Côte" vineyard. By integrating the grapes from our own vineyards, we also use those from selected "Cœur de Terroir" parcels from partner winemakers.

The grape varieties used are distributed as follows: 42% Chardonnay, 40% Pinot Noir and 18% Meunier. The 243rd blend of Maison Roederer includes 31% perpetual reserve wines from the 2012, 2013, 2014, 2015, 2016 and 2017 vintages. In addition, we use 10% reserve wines aged in wood from the 2009, 2011, 2013, 2014, 2015, 2016 and 2017 vintages.

For the 2018 harvest, 59% of the grapes were used. Only 26% of the wine underwent malolactic fermentation. The dosage is 8g/l.

Champagne Collection 243 presents itself with a bright gold color with iridescent reflections. Its effervescence is fine and dynamic, with a very persistent perlage. The bouquet is immediate, ample and pleasantly fresh. It is a triumph of ripe and delicate fruits, in which you can precisely recognize the yellow fruits such as the mirabelle plum of the Pinot Noir and the sugary citrus fruits such as the lemon cake. You can also detect aromas of delicate white flowers such as the jasmine of the Chardonnay. After a few minutes, notes of autolysis emerge, with smoky hints and lightly toasted pastry.
In the mouth, the wine is dense, deep, with a rich and structured texture. The texture is intriguing, while the full-bodied material of the Pinot Noir floats in the mouth and lingers with an immense saline freshness and a hint of bitterness. This wine combines the strength, intensity and power of the Pinot Noir with the mastery and maturity, deliciously balanced by the chalky freshness and density of the Chardonnays that dominate this blend.
The warm and delicious style of the Champagne Collection 243 is due to the perfect maturation of the 2018 vintage. But the freshness, energy and complexity of the Réserve Perpétuelle created in 2012, as well as the woody texture given by the oak, relax and prolong the material, giving it finesse and persistence!

The Maison Louis Roederer's "Collection" project was born in response to contemporary issues related to environmental sustainability and climate change. The goal is to create ever-better champagnes, using the vintages available to the Maison. One of the peculiarities of Louis Roederer is the large availability of reserve wines aged in wood. Thanks to these refinements, the wines evolve slowly over time, increasing oxygenation, roundness and complexity, offering a unique sip for each Collection. The number on the label refers to the blends used since the foundation of the Maison.
